The round hive top feeder is a versatile tool designed to provide supplemental nutrition to honeybee colonies. It primarily functions as an in hive feeder for liquid syrups, dry pollen, or granulated sugar, depending on the configuration. The included insert minimizes drowning risks during liquid feeding, while the open-top design accommodates dry feeding methods. Its placement within the hive body ensures direct colony access while protecting feed from external elements. This feeder proves particularly useful during seasons when natural forage is scarce, supporting colony health and productivity through controlled nutritional supplementation.
Key Points Explained:
-
Primary Function - Liquid Syrup Feeding
- Designed to hold sugar syrup (commonly 2:1 or 1:1 sugar-to-water ratios) for colony nourishment.
- The insert creates a safe drinking surface, preventing bee drownings by limiting direct contact with large liquid volumes.
- Ideal for fall/winter feeding when natural nectar sources diminish.
-
Alternative Dry Feeding Capabilities
- Can dispense dry pollen substitutes or granulated sugar when used without the insert.
- Open-top configuration allows bees to access powdered or crystalline feed directly.
- Useful for protein supplementation during brood-rearing seasons.
-
Strategic Placement & Colony Access
- Installed within an empty hive body above the brood box, integrating seamlessly with existing hive infrastructure.
- Internal positioning protects feed from weather, pests, and robbing by other colonies.
- Enables beekeepers to monitor consumption without frequent hive disturbances.
-
Seasonal Adaptability
- Supports heavy syrup feeding in colder months to boost winter stores.
- Facilitates spring stimulative feeding with lighter syrups to encourage brood production.
- Dry pollen feeding aids early-season colony buildup when natural pollen is scarce.
-
Safety & Maintenance Considerations
- The insert’s design balances efficient feeding with bee safety, reducing labor-intensive cleanups of drowned bees.
- Wooden construction (in some models) provides insulation against temperature fluctuations.
- Easy to refill and clean between uses, promoting hive hygiene.
